干涉显微镜在超精密测量中的应用 被引量:2

摘要 介绍了干涉显微镜测量原理、仪器结构、空间分辨率和测量范围,分析了测量误差产生的原因,通过实验表明:干涉显微镜能够比较真实地反映超光滑表面微观形貌特征。 This paper introduces the measuring principles,instrument structures ,spacial resolutions and their application domain of interomicroscopy.The measuring errors are also analyzed ,the results show that interomicroscopy can measure truly the characteristic of ultra-smooth surface microtopography,it is a useful tool in measuring of ultra-smooth surface microtopography.
出处 《佳木斯大学学报(自然科学版)》 CAS 1999年第4期420-424,共5页 Journal of Jiamusi University:Natural Science Edition
关键词 干涉显微镜 表面微观形貌 超精密测量 interomicroscopy surface microtopography measuring
